Canadian River Outfitters owner, Tom Bruhn was born
and raised in Logan, New Mexico, where Ute Creek and the Canadian River
meet at Ute Lake. As a fifth
generation New Mexico rancher, there is no doubt that his life experiences
on the property would obviously leave his knowledge of the terrain and
wildlife unmatched by other outfitters.
His passion for ranching and proper management for land, livestock,
and wildlife makes the services of Canadian River Outfitters a natural
fit. All of our hunts are 100% fair chase, and all tags are guaranteed,
meaning you will not need to compete in the New Mexico draw to hunt with
Canadian River Outfitters.
The personal property of Canadian River Outfitters
consists of nearly 10,000 acres of prime New Mexico hunting ground for
mule deer, antelope, turkey, ducks, game birds and of course, coyotes and
prairie dogs. Outfitter and
guide Tom Bruhn has worked this property all of his life, and knows how
the game move and how to get hunters the best shot. Canadian
River Outfitters has hunting access to an additional 12,000 acres of
private land in the area to enhance your New Mexico hunting experience.
